Fir is harder and stronger than pine spruce or hemlock and it s less likely to have knots or other blemishes.

Is a fir tree a hardwood.

Fir tree appreciation day is june 18. Softwood trees are evergreen or needle bearing e g. Pine fir spruce redwood cedar cypress and hemlock. Balsa is a hardwood but its wood is so soft and lightweight that it s most commonly used for making model airplanes.

However douglas fir which is a gymnosperm or softwood is actually harder than chestnut an angiosperm that most people would call a hardwood.
